What is…

Meaning: God is its fear

This is an ancient city in the tribe of Dan.

It was a city of refuge and a Levitical city (Joshua 21:23; 19:44).

Archaeologists have suggested that it may be located at Tel Shalaf in Israel or possibly at the Palestinian town of Beit Liqya, Israel (a.k.a. Bayt Liqya or Beit Likia).

Tel Shalaf in Israel near the modern town of Ge'alya —satellite view
Bayt Liqya, Israel —satellite view

More information

May 17, 2024